I\'m So Ashamed...
I went to a new stylist today and let me first give her her props!(I'll tell you why I'm so ashamed in a minute) I was pleased and I, Ms. Anti-Scissor Happy let her give me a trim. We "discussed" it first because I told her that I don't let anyone (but me) put scissors in my hair. She asked why--I told her because of SHS's. She said "you don't know how many people sit in my chair and tell me that." She showed me how much she thought needed trimming. I agreed (about 1/2 inch) +I did a little trim a few weeks ago. But somehow, I don't feel bad. I actually like the way my hair looks and it wasn't one of those big scissor happy chops. With trims like this--I can still get progress.
Anyway, the reason I'm so ashamed: She asked me what products I used. I named Creme Of Nature Shampoo, as well as Biolage and Kenra for my conditioners. So then she recommends the Keracare line to me. And I'm like "Oh, I have that!" So later, she asked me if I'd ever tried any Aveda products and I was like "Yeah, I like the Sap Moss Shampoo."
Then she caught on and just started asking me about different products. It's funny because I was able to respond to her about 95% of what she asked me about. But just think of all the product recommendations I can give to friends and Hair Buddies on the board...
She's a JC Penney stylist so once again, YOU GO JC PENNEY!
I feel like she and I were "in sync" and I haven't felt like that with a stylist in a long time!
